A package to render go diagrams and embed them in reStructuredText documents

Project description

rstgo is a package for parsing go diagrams of the style used at the Sensei’s Library and rendering them using reStructuredText. It was designed for embedding dynamically generated images of go games into reST documents, particularly for pelican blogs or sphinx documentation.

The code lives at http://bitbucket.org/cliff/rstgo. Bug reports, feature requests, and contributions are all welcome. If you find the code useful, hop on bitbucket and send me a quick message letting me know.

To use with sphinx, add ‘rstgo.rst’ to your list of extensions.

To use with pelican, add the following to your pelican configuration file

from rstgo import rst rst.setup_pelican()

To Do

  • Diagrams should render captions and metadata.

  • Sequences should accept starting numbers > 1.

  • Non-alphanumeric annotations should work as described in the Sensei’s Library.

  • Numbering should accept other fonts and use a condensed font for numbers above 9 (or 20, or whenever it gets too wide).

  • If condensed fonts are still too big, it should dynamically resize itself.
